Darryl Williams, International karate official and coordinator of referees for the World United Karate Organization (WUKO), has been invited to conduct National referee course for the Association of Professional Martial Artists (APMA) of St. Lucia. APMA is WUKO representative for St. Lucia and registered with the St. Lucia Ministry of Youth and Sports Development. Its President is Benny Chitolie.
This is part of APMA National Martial Arts tournament which will take place March 22nd and 23rd at the Beausejour Indoor Sports Facility located in Gros-Islet,St.Lucia.
Teams from the Caribbean as well as the United States are expected to attend the major event. Trinidad and Tobago Karate Federation (TTKF) will also be represented. Williams has been a karate referee since 1982 and is now among the top officials in the World. He conducts courses all over the World for major karate organizations.
